Description

I created a docker with the redis unstable branch and neural redis installed in it. I ran it on an AWS t2.micro instance, and tried to create a neural network just to play with. The docker crashed with the below bug report. The machine is just too small to work with it?

Dockerfile largely copied from [the standard redis 3.2 dockerfile](https://github.com/docker-library/redis/blob/a38166e6f3430512ba8ce2cb5ebd889ee17b9dc4/3.2/Dockerfile):

```
FROM debian:jessie

# TAKEN FROM:
# https://github.com/docker-library/redis/blob/a38166e6f3430512ba8ce2cb5ebd889ee17b9dc4/3.2/Dockerfile
# add our user and group first to make sure their IDs get assigned consistently, regardless of whatever dependencies get added
RUN groupadd -r redis && useradd -r -g redis redis

RUN apt-get update && apt-get install -y --no-install-recommends \
ca-certificates \
wget \
&& rm -rf /var/lib/apt/lists/*

# grab gosu for easy step-down from root
ENV GOSU_VERSION 1.7
RUN set -x \
&& wget -O /usr/local/bin/gosu "https://github.com/tianon/gosu/releases/download/$GOSU_VERSION/gosu-$(dpkg --print-architecture)" \
&& wget -O /usr/local/bin/gosu.asc "https://github.com/tianon/gosu/releases/download/$GOSU_VERSION/gosu-$(dpkg --print-architecture).asc" \
&& export GNUPGHOME="$(mktemp -d)" \
&& gpg --keyserver ha.pool.sks-keyservers.net --recv-keys B42F6819007F00F88E364FD4036A9C25BF357DD4 \
&& gpg --batch --verify /usr/local/bin/gosu.asc /usr/local/bin/gosu \
&& rm -r "$GNUPGHOME" /usr/local/bin/gosu.asc \
&& chmod +x /usr/local/bin/gosu \
&& gosu nobody true

# Common dependencies
RUN apt-get update && apt-get install -y \
gcc \
libc6-dev \
make \
git \
&& rm -rf /var/lib/apt/lists/*

# Github redis unstable install
RUN mkdir -p /usr/src \
&& git clone https://github.com/antirez/redis.git /usr/src/redis \
\
# Disable Redis protected mode [1] as it is unnecessary in context
# of Docker. Ports are not automatically exposed when running inside
# Docker, but rather explicitely by specifying -p / -P.
# [1] https://github.com/antirez/redis/commit/edd4d555df57dc84265fdfb4ef59a4678832f6da
&& grep -q '^#define CONFIG_DEFAULT_PROTECTED_MODE 1$' /usr/src/redis/src/server.h \
&& sed -ri 's!^(#define CONFIG_DEFAULT_PROTECTED_MODE) 1$!\1 0!' /usr/src/redis/src/server.h \
&& grep -q '^#define CONFIG_DEFAULT_PROTECTED_MODE 0$' /usr/src/redis/src/server.h \
# for future reference, we modify this directly in the source instead of just supplying a default configuration flag because apparently "if you specify any argument to redis-server, [it assumes] you are going to specify everything"
# see also https://github.com/docker-library/redis/issues/4#issuecomment-50780840
# (more exactly, this makes sure the default behavior of "save on SIGTERM" stays functional by default)
\
&& make -C /usr/src/redis \
&& make -C /usr/src/redis install \
\
&& rm -r /usr/src/redis

# Neural redis install
RUN mkdir -p /usr/src \
&& git clone https://github.com/antirez/neural-redis.git /usr/src/neural-redis \
&& make -C /usr/src/neural-redis avx

# Remove common dependencies
RUN apt-get purge -y --auto-remove \
gcc \
libc6-dev \
make \
git

RUN mkdir /data && chown redis:redis /data
VOLUME /data
WORKDIR /data

COPY docker-entrypoint.sh /usr/local/bin/
RUN chmod +x /usr/local/bin/docker-entrypoint.sh
ENTRYPOINT ["docker-entrypoint.sh"]

EXPOSE 6379
CMD [ "redis-server", "--loadmodule", "/usr/src/neural-redis/neuralredis.so" ]
```
